Output 70aa7436f910954c84e13b1fb97f0de0272e886b208cdee7a0b608d2f957a58e:0

value
256226
script pubkey
OP_0 OP_PUSHBYTES_20 57bfff1e18eea2068398dc6baa0a76a3cab2359b
address
bc1q27ll78sca63qdqucm3465znk509tydvmltj94f
transaction
70aa7436f910954c84e13b1fb97f0de0272e886b208cdee7a0b608d2f957a58e